Some of us find baking therapeutic, while some of us deal by stress-eating (who are we to judge). Festival writers share their favourite dishes and recipes for eating their feelings or channeling them into a full-fledged feast. Consider this an ode to cathartic cooking, or to food and eating in general, as the speakers also read works that express their relationship with food.
This programme includes a live Q&A towards the end of the session.

Kishan Singh calls himself a science educator because he believes that science should be for everyone. He is interested in exploring how different groups of people perceive science and has been published in the Journal of Biological Education. However, his proudest moments remain accosting people in clubs about the chemistry of tonic, and getting teenagers excited about science in the classroom. Kishan is one half of the best-friend podcast, T42.
